They look great. You may consider "aging" the decal by cracking, scraping and discoloring. Matt has cut them up to resemble cracking as he demonstrated on an earlier post. Practice on some contact paper to get the desired look before working on the decal. Please post your results. Good luck. Dave

I would like to say thanks to Advertologest, Matt Alvarez, Hancock oil, and a huge thanks to Jim at T-way’s graphics. They all were instrumental in getting this lost original design decal made again. This design was taken from an original 1929 Hancock sales brochure and from an opening day photo from around the mid to late 30’s Hancock gas station with Wayne 60 pumps.

After finishing my 60 I wasn’t happy with the decal I had chosen, and wanted something different other than the standard Hancock pump decal or 5 point decals. My second dilemma after having the decals re-created was coming up with a good ad glass to match. Randy had an original cardboard motor oil sign, and sent me a good photo of it, so I forwarded in on to Jim at T-way’s to have it made into an ad glass.

Now I can say I am very pleased with the finished pump! I hope you enjoy the photo. Thanks again Anthony
